Technical Description

St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in i2A-Cronos version 23.02.01.17, from i2A. It allows an authenticated attacker to upload a malicious SVG image into the user's personal space in /CronosWeb/Modules/Persons/PersonalDocuments/PersonalDocuments.

There is no reported fix at this time.
